Fairview Microwave releases BMA connectors and adapters with VSWR as low as 1.15:1

June 20, 2017 By Mary Gannon Leave a Comment

Fairview-Microwave-BMA-Connectors-and-Adapters-SQFairview Microwave Inc. has launched a new product line made-up of 45 BMA connectors with VSWR as low as 1.2:1, and seven BMA adapters with VSWR as low as 1.15:1. Typical applications include blind mating, RF backplanes, rack and panel connectivity, high-speed switching and use in phased array systems.

Fairview’s new line of 54 BMA connectors and BMA adapters provide a maximum operating frequency of 22 GHz. They feature 50 Ohm impedance, gold-plated BeCu contacts and an operating temperature range of –65° to 125°C. Radial and axial float is offered in many of the models to help with alignment. Commercial versions are constructed of brass and military versions are made of stainless steel. Hermetic versions are also available. These BMA connectors and BMA adapters are ideally suited for telecommunications and military electronics applications.
